سبد دانلود 0

تگ های موضوع هوش مصنوعی و شطرنج

هوش مصنوعی و شطرنج: یک تحلیل جامع و کامل


در دنیای فناوری‌های نوین، یکی از حوزه‌های پرجنب‌وجوش و پرپیشرفت، هوش مصنوعی (AI) است که تاثیر عمیقی بر بسیاری از عرصه‌ها داشته است. یکی از نمونه‌های برجسته‌ی کاربردهای هوش مصنوعی در زندگی روزمره، بازی شطرنج است. این بازی، که قدمتی چند صد ساله دارد، به عنوان آزمایشگاهی عالی برای توسعه و ارزیابی فناوری‌های هوشمند شناخته می‌شود. در ادامه، به صورت جامع و تفصیلی، رابطه‌ی میان هوش مصنوعی و شطرنج بررسی می‌شود، و تاثیر این فناوری بر روی توسعه‌ی بازی، استراتژی‌های آن، و آینده‌ی این حوزه مورد تحلیل قرار می‌گیرد.
تاریخچه‌ی توسعه‌ی هوش مصنوعی در بازی شطرنج
در دهه‌های میانی قرن بیستم، توسعه‌ی هوش مصنوعی همزمان با پیشرفت‌های گسترده در علوم رایانه شکل گرفت. در همان زمان، توسعه‌ی برنامه‌های کامپیوتری برای بازی شطرنج آغاز شد، چرا که این بازی، با قوانین مشخص و استراتژی‌های پیچیده، به عنوان یک چالش بزرگ برای ماشین‌ها محسوب می‌شد. نخستین برنامه‌های شطرنج، که در دهه 1950 ساخته شدند، توانایی انجام محاسبات محدود و تصمیم‌گیری‌های ساده را داشتند، اما به مرور زمان و با پیشرفت‌های فناوری، برنامه‌ها توانستند استراتژی‌های پیچیده‌تر و هوشمندانه‌تر پیاده‌سازی کنند.
در اواخر قرن بیستم، برنامه‌هایی مانند *Deep Thought* و *Deep Blue* به شهرت رسیدند. به خصوص، پروژه‌ی *Deep Blue*، که توسط IBM توسعه یافته بود، موفق شد در سال 1997، گوینده‌ی مشهور جهان، گاری کاسپاروف، را شکست دهد. این رویداد، نقطه‌ی عطفی در تاریخ هوش مصنوعی و بازی‌های استراتژیک محسوب می‌شود. اما، نباید فراموش کرد که این برنامه‌ها، هرچند توانمند، هنوز محدودیت‌هایی داشتند، و بیشتر بر پایه‌ی محاسبات سریع و جستجوهای عمیق بودند.
هوش مصنوعی و الگوریتم‌های مورد استفاده در شطرنج
امروزه، فناوری‌های هوش مصنوعی در بازی شطرنج، به طور کلی، بر پایه‌ی الگوریتم‌های پیچیده و یادگیری ماشین استوار هستند. یکی از مهم‌ترین این الگوریتم‌ها، *شبکه‌های عصبی مصنوعی* است که قادر است الگوهای پیچیده و غیرقابل‌پیش‌بینی را تحلیل کند. همچنین، *یادگیری تقویتی* (Reinforcement Learning) نقش مهمی در توسعه‌ی برنامه‌های مدرن ایفا می‌کند.
در الگوریتم‌های مدرن، برنامه‌های شطرنج، به جای صرفاً جستجو در فهرست حرکت‌ها و ارزیابی‌های دستی، از شبکه‌های عصبی استفاده می‌کنند تا بتوانند استراتژی‌های جدید و هوشمندانه‌تر طراحی کنند. به عنوان مثال، برنامه‌ی *Stockfish* یا *AlphaZero*، که توسط شرکت‌هایی مانند DeepMind توسعه یافته‌اند، توانسته‌اند در رقابت با بهترین برنامه‌های قدیمی، نتایج درخشانی کسب کنند. به خصوص، *AlphaZero*، با بهره‌گیری از یادگیری تقویتی، توانست در مدت کوتاهی به استراتژی‌هایی برسد که حتی بهترین بازیکنان انسانی، درک عمیقی از آن‌ها نداشتند.
نقش یادگیری ماشین و شبکه‌های عصبی در پیشرفت‌های اخیر
در گذشته، برنامه‌های شطرنج بیشتر بر پایه‌ی استراتژی‌های جستجو و ارزیابی‌های ثابت بودند. ولی، حالا، با بهره‌گیری از یادگیری ماشین، این برنامه‌ها، قادر به تحلیل موارد بسیار پیچیده‌تر و تصمیم‌گیری‌های هوشمندانه‌تر هستند. برای مثال، *AlphaZero* توانست در مدت کوتاهی، پس از آموزش بر روی میلیون‌ها بازی، استراتژی‌هایی را توسعه دهد که شباهتی به استراتژی‌های انسانی نداشت، بلکه کاملاً نوین و نوآورانه بودند.
این پیشرفت‌ها، نه تنها سطح بازی‌های کامپیوتری را بالا برد، بلکه تاثیر عمیقی بر روی آموزش و توسعه‌ی بازیکنان انسانی داشتند. اکنون، بازیکنان می‌توانند از برنامه‌های پیشرفته برای تحلیل بازی‌ها، کشف اشتباهات، و یادگیری استراتژی‌های جدید بهره‌مند شوند. این، به نوعی، تبدیل به یک استاد مجازی شده است که هرگز خسته نمی‌شود و همیشه آماده است به بازیکنان کمک کند.
تاثیر هوش مصنوعی بر روی استراتژی و آموزش در شطرنج
یکی از مهم‌ترین اثرات هوش مصنوعی بر بازی شطرنج، در حوزه‌ی آموزش است. با توسعه‌ی نرم‌افزارهای مبتنی بر AI، مربیان و بازیکنان، ابزارهای قدرتمندی برای تحلیل بازی‌ها و تمرین‌های استراتژیک دارند. به عنوان نمونه، برنامه‌هایی مانند *Leela Chess Zero* یا *Stockfish*، نه تنها بازی‌ها را تحلیل می‌کنند، بلکه پیشنهاداتی هوشمندانه و نوآورانه ارائه می‌دهند، که قبلاً در دنیای انسانی دیده نمی‌شد.
علاوه بر این، هوش مصنوعی، استراتژی‌های نوین و روش‌های جدید بازی را وارد دنیای رقابت‌های حرفه‌ای کرده است. در نتیجه، بازیکنان، دیگر تنها بر مبنای تجربیات و آموزش‌های کلاسیک، بلکه بر پایه‌ی داده‌های عظیم و تحلیل‌های پیچیده، بازی می‌کنند. این، موجب شده است که سطح بازی‌ها به شدت ارتقا یابد و رقابت‌ها پرشورتر و چالش‌برانگیزتر شوند.
چالش‌ها و آینده‌ی هوش مصنوعی در شطرنج
با وجود پیشرفت‌های قابل توجه، هنوز هم چالش‌هایی در راه توسعه‌ی هوش مصنوعی در بازی شطرنج وجود دارد. یکی از این چالش‌ها، نیاز به منابع محاسباتی عظیم است؛ چرا که آموزش مدل‌های پیشرفته، نیازمند داده‌های فراوان و قدرت پردازش بالا است. همچنین، مساله‌ی تعادل میان استراتژی‌های انسانی و هوشمندانه‌ی ماشین‌ها، همچنان محل بحث و مناقشه است.
در آینده، پیش‌بینی می‌شود که فناوری‌های هوشمند، همچنان در حوزه‌ی آموزش، تحلیل، و توسعه‌ی استراتژی‌های بازی، نقش ایفا کنند. به خصوص، با پیشرفت‌های در حوزه‌ی *یادگیری عمیق* و *شبکه‌های عصبی عمیق‌تر*، برنامه‌های شطرنج، می‌توانند به صورت خودآموز و مستقل، استراتژی‌های نوین را کشف کنند که حتی انسان‌ها نیز به آن‌ها نرسیده‌اند. این، نه تنها سطح بازی را به نحو چشمگیری ارتقا می‌دهد، بلکه به عنوان یک ابزار علمی و پژوهشی، تحقیقات در حوزه‌ی هوش مصنوعی و استراتژی‌های بازی را هم غنی‌تر می‌سازد.
نتیجه‌گیری
در مجموع، رابطه‌ی میان هوش مصنوعی و بازی شطرنج، یک نمونه‌ی بی‌نظیر از پیشرفت‌های فناوری است که، نه تنها، به توسعه‌ی بازی کمک کرده، بلکه تاثیر عمیقی بر آموزش، استراتژی، و رقابت‌های حرفه‌ای داشته است. با پیشرفت‌های روزافزون در حوزه‌ی یادگیری ماشین و شبکه‌های عصبی، آینده‌ی این حوزه، پر از امکانات و فرصت‌های جدید است. بی‌تردید، هوش مصنوعی، در کنار انسان، به عنوان شریک استراتژیک، نقش مهمی در شکل‌گیری آینده‌ی بازی‌های فکری و استراتژیک ایفا خواهد کرد، و این روند، بی‌وقفه ادامه خواهد داشت.
مشاهده بيشتر